Considering The Fuji Finepix 2800 Was The First Di
Considering the Fuji Finepix 2800 was the first digital camera I ever bought, I didn't do too badly. Would I buy another Fuji? I doubt it. And, I'll tell you why. Just after I bought it the smart media became almost impossible to locate. Come to find out, it is no longer made. (So, I hope my film chip lasts!)
Faces tend to go on the red side. Thank goodness I have Photoshop! But still, a less red-biased profile could have been used. (Does Fuji use that awful SRGB?)
Hot spots in the flash are very annoying. I've helped to reduce it by playing around with the EV.

Being A Novice To Taking Digital Pictures, I Was A
Being a novice to taking digital pictures, i was amazed at this little package. The first thing that caught my attention about the Fuji Finepix 2800 Digital camera was the easy setup. After turning on the camera for the first time it asked for the date and time, no searching through pages of instructions to find out how to do this. The next thing that caught my attention was the handling of this camera, all the buttons where either at my finger tips, or could be operated with the thumb i found this to be really good as after a very short time i didn't have to keep checking if i was pressing the right button or not.
the 6x optical zoom was good, The macro for close shots was amazing,
power consumption on my first set of batteries was not good but the secound set have lasted longer so i'll put that down to the shelf life of the batteries.
the only bad points i have about this camera are:
when you press the button to take a pic, there is a delay untill the camera actually takes the pic. At first, my pics where coming out blured untill i got used to this delay.
when i erase or format the memory card the counter resets it's self to 000000. while this ok for the camera, you need to be careful and lable/tag all your pics as you could end up with a lot of pics with the same number and confussion will set in.
while taking a pic in dark places was hard and a hit or miss thing, harsh flash,
i dont use voice recording so no big deal there.
As i said at the beginning i am a complete novice to taking digital pics, But this little camera has me hooked, from the moment i picked it up and took my first picture. (i only have it a week)thumbs up a really amazing little camera.
